- Cómo conectar Java con Elasticsearch?
- ¿Qué es elasticsearch utilizado para java??
- Cómo crear un índice en Elasticsearch usando Java?
- ¿Qué es el cliente de transporte en elasticsearch??
- ¿Elasticsearch se ejecuta en java??
- ¿Se requiere Java para ElasticSearch?
- ¿Elasticsearch usa kafka??
- ¿Netflix usa elasticsearch??
- ¿Es Elasticsearch una herramienta ETL??
- ¿Funciona la indexación en Java??
- ¿Cómo se realiza la indexación en Java??
- Cómo obtener todos los índices en Elasticsearch en Java?
- ¿Qué es elasticsearch transport vs http??
- ¿Cuál es la diferencia entre el cliente de nodo y el cliente de transporte en elasticsearch??
- ¿Puedo usar Elasticsearch Client para OpenSearch??
- ¿Cómo me conecto con elasticsearch??
- ¿Puedes ssh con java??
- ¿Cómo me conecto con Zookeeper en Java??
- ¿Cuál es la URL de elasticsearch??
- ¿Cuál es la dirección IP para elasticsearch??
- Elasticsearch es frontend o backend?
- ¿Elasticsearch usa log4j??
- ¿Cómo obtengo más de 10000 hits en elasticsearch??
Cómo conectar Java con Elasticsearch?
En instalaciones autogestionadas, ElasticSearch comenzará con características de seguridad como autenticación y TLS habilitado para. Para conectarse al clúster Elasticsearch, deberá configurar el cliente de la API Java para usar HTTPS con el certificado CA generado para realizar solicitudes con éxito.
¿Qué es elasticsearch utilizado para java??
Inicialmente lanzado en 2010, Elasticsearch (a veces DUBBEDE) es un motor de búsqueda y análisis moderno que se basa en Apache Lucene. Código de código abierto y construido con Java, Elasticsearch es una base de datos NoSQL. Eso significa que almacena datos de manera no estructurada y que no puede usar SQL para consultarlo.
Cómo crear un índice en Elasticsearch usando Java?
Esta API se usa para crear un índice. Se puede crear un índice enviando una solicitud de put sin cuerpo o con mapeo, configuración y alias adecuados. Se crea automáticamente un índice cada vez que un usuario pasa los objetos JSON a cualquier índice.
¿Qué es el cliente de transporte en elasticsearch??
El cliente de transporte permite crear un cliente que no forme parte del clúster, sino que simplemente se conecta a uno o más nodos directamente agregando sus respectivas direcciones utilizando AddTransportAddress (Org. elasticsearch. común.
¿Elasticsearch se ejecuta en java??
Elasticsearch se construye con Java e incluye una versión agrupada de OpenJDK de los mantenedores JDK (GPLV2+CE) dentro de cada distribución. El JVM Bundled es el JVM recomendado y se encuentra dentro del directorio JDK del Directorio de inicio de ElasticSearch.
¿Se requiere Java para ElasticSearch?
Nota: Elasticsearch requiere al menos Java versión 7, pero para elasticsearch versión 1.7. 1 Se recomienda que use Oracle JDK versión 1.8. 0_25 o superior en el sistema operativo que implementa el servidor Elasticsearch. Por lo tanto, configure java_home en consecuencia.
¿Elasticsearch usa kafka??
Muchas compañías aprovechan tanto Apache Kafka como la pila elástica (Elasticsearch, Logstash y Kibana) para el procesamiento de registros y/o eventos. Kafka a menudo se usa como capa de transporte, almacenamiento y procesamiento de datos, típicamente grandes cantidades de datos.
¿Netflix usa elasticsearch??
Descripción general. Con 700-800 nodos de producción repartidos en 100 clústeres de elasticsearch, Netflix está empujando el sobre cuando se trata de extraer ideas en tiempo real a gran escala.
¿Es Elasticsearch una herramienta ETL??
No, Elasticsearch no es una herramienta ETL. Es un motor de búsqueda gratuito y de código abierto para datos de texto, numéricos, geoespaciales, estructurados y no estructurados. Elasticsearch se utiliza principalmente en inteligencia empresarial, inteligencia de seguridad e inteligencia operativa. Hay herramientas ETL separadas disponibles para ElasticSearch.
¿Funciona la indexación en Java??
El método indexOf () se usa en Java para recuperar la posición de índice en la que aparece un carácter o subcadena particular en otra cadena. Puede usar un segundo argumento para iniciar su búsqueda después de un número de índice particular en la cadena. Si no se puede encontrar la letra o las letras especificadas, índicef () devuelve -1.
¿Cómo se realiza la indexación en Java??
Método Java String indexOf ()
El método indexOf () devuelve la posición de la primera ocurrencia de cargos especificados en una cadena. Consejo: use el método LastIndexof para devolver la posición de la última aparición de carácter especificados en una cadena.
Cómo obtener todos los índices en Elasticsearch en Java?
var RestClient = RestClient. Builder (nuevo httphost ("localhost", 9200)). construir(); Var Transport = new RestClientTransport (RestClient, New JacksonJSONPMapper ()); client vzr = new ElasticSearchClient (transporte); VAR ÍNDICES = Cliente. índices().
¿Qué es elasticsearch transport vs http??
Elasticsearch tiene dos niveles de comunicaciones, comunicaciones de transporte y comunicaciones HTTP. El protocolo de transporte se utiliza para comunicaciones internas entre los nodos de ElasticSearch, y el protocolo HTTP se utiliza para las comunicaciones de los clientes al clúster Elasticsearch.
¿Cuál es la diferencia entre el cliente de nodo y el cliente de transporte en elasticsearch??
El cliente de nodo se une a un clúster local como nodo sin datos. En otras palabras, no contiene ningún dato en sí mismo, pero sabe qué datos viven en qué nodo en el clúster, y puede reenviar las solicitudes directamente al nodo correcto. El cliente de transporte de peso más ligero se puede usar para enviar solicitudes a un clúster remoto.
¿Puedo usar Elasticsearch Client para OpenSearch??
Sí. OpenSearch es compatible con los índices creados a partir de las versiones de Elasticsearch 6.0 hasta 7.10.
¿Cómo me conecto con elasticsearch??
Hay dos formas de conectarse a su clúster ElasticSearch: a través de la API RESTFUL o a través del cliente de transporte de Java. Ambas formas usan una URL de punto final que incluye un puerto, como https: // EC47FC4D2C53414E1307E85726D4B9BB.US-East-1.AWS.encontró.IO: 9243 .
¿Puedes ssh con java??
JSCH es la implementación de Java de SSH2 que nos permite conectarnos a un servidor SSH y usar el reenvío de puertos, el reenvío X11 y la transferencia de archivos. Además, tiene licencia bajo la licencia de estilo BSD y nos proporciona una manera fácil de establecer una conexión SSH con Java.
¿Cómo me conecto con Zookeeper en Java??
Java. En el método principal, cree un objeto de tipo ZOOKEEPERCONECHE y llame al método de conexión para conectarse al conjunto ZOOKEEPER. El método de conexión devolverá el objeto ZOOKEEper ZK. Ahora, llame al método Crear objeto ZK con ruta y datos personalizados.
¿Cuál es la URL de elasticsearch??
La URL de su servidor ElasticSearch es: https: // elasticsearch.mi dominio.com: 9200/blog_search/post/_search. Algunos conflictos de seguridad de CORS con los navegadores pueden ocurrir si tiene otro subdominio. Además, con un punto final público de ElasticSearch, es posible solicitar todos los índices de su servicio de búsqueda.
¿Cuál es la dirección IP para elasticsearch??
De forma predeterminada, elasticsearch solo se puede acceder desde localhost o la dirección IP 127.0. 0.1.
Elasticsearch es frontend o backend?
Si está utilizando AWS Elasticsearch y necesita algún tipo de autenticación, debe dejar que el backend hable con Elasticsearch (back -end usando los roles de IAM para generar la firma de AWS). Si lo hace a través de Frontend, es posible que deba exponer sus secretos, que obviamente no es una buena estrategia.
¿Elasticsearch usa log4j??
Elasticsearch usa log4j 2 para registrar.
¿Cómo obtengo más de 10000 hits en elasticsearch??
Por defecto, no puede usar el tamaño y el tamaño para la página a través de más de 10,000 hits. Este límite es una salvaguardia establecida por el índice. MAX_RESULT_WINDOW ÍNDICE. Si necesita revisar más de 10,000 visitas, use el parámetro Search_After en su lugar.